Chemical Engineer: What does one do in the profession?

As a Chemical Engineer, you work on developing and improving chemical processes and products. Tasks often include laboratory work, analysis, and quality control. You may also work on optimizing production processes within the industry. The work environment varies from laboratories to production facilities, depending on specialization and employer.

Chemical Engineer salary: What does a Chemical Engineer earn?

The average salary for a Chemical Engineer is 43 600 SEK per month. However, there is a certain gender pay gap where women earn 42,800 SEK and men 44 000 SEK. The hourly wage for a part-time employee averages 256 SEK.

Salary development over time

We see a positive salary development for Chemical Engineers. Last year, the average salary was 42 500 SEK, which means an increase to this year's 43 600 SEK. This indicates a stable and increasing demand for the profession.

Education and qualifications

To become a Chemical Engineer, a university degree in chemistry or chemical engineering is usually required. Some employers may also accept a high school education with a technical focus and relevant work experience.

Who has the highest salary?
The highest salary for a Chemical technician is 45100 kr. This salary belongs to a man working in the Privately employed officials with a post-secondary education, less than 3 years. The highest salary for a woman in this profession is 43300 kr.
Who has the lowest salary?
The lowest salary for a Chemical technician is 31900 kr. This salary belongs to a woman also working in the Public sector. The lowest salary for a man in this profession is 42600 kr.
Salary distributed by age and sector
Age Women's salary as a percentage of men's Base salary Monthly salary
25-34 100% 38800 kr 39500 kr
35-44 107% 43500 kr 44300 kr
45-54 104% 48700 kr 49600 kr
55-64 91% 46000 kr 47200 kr
Snitt 98% 42800 kr 43600 kr

About the data

All information displayed on this page is based on data from the Swedish Central Bureau of Statistics (SCB), the Swedish Tax Agency and the Swedish employment agency. Learn more about our data and data sources here.

All figures are gross salaries, meaning salaries before tax. The average salary, or mean salary, is calculated by adding up the total salary for all individuals within the profession and dividing it by the number of individuals. For specific job categories, we have also considered various criteria such as experience and education.

Profession Chemical technician has the SSYK code 3115, which we use to match against the SCB database to obtain the latest salary statistics.
